oh, yeah, get yourself a temp gauge, ...you can get one for like $30 from most hobby stores. Mine is about the size of a key fob for your 1:1 car ...I keep it in my pocket on race day and practices ...I measure temps after each heat. In general you don't want your motor getting above about 165-170. I always keep my motor temp below 160, usually 155ish.
